Foods to help lose weightWeight loss is a serious business in the present times with many people suffering from obesity. Regular exercise is great for building muscle and losing fat, but if you want to see real weight-loss results, what you eat matters. But dropping pounds is not about depriving yourself and it is about choosing the right foods that satisfy without the calories.

These are some of the best healthy foods to consume in order to shed weight.

Inexpensive, filling, and versatile, beans are a great source of protein. Beans are also high in fiber and slow to digest. That means you feel full longer, which may stop you from eating more. A cup of beans packs a whopping 15 grams of satisfying protein and does not contain any of the saturated fat found in other protein sources.

Salmon are an excellent source of omega-3 fatty acids, which are great for a myriad of reasons, including lower blood pressure and a healthier heart. But omega-3s may also help reduce inflammation in your body, which can help you recover faster after a long workout to build more metabolism-boosting muscles in the long run. Salmon’s high protein content make it an excellent choice for a weight-loss-worthy dinner.

The breakfast cereal for a bowl of oatmeal, and you just may see the pounds disappear. A recent survey found that those who ate oatmeal instead of cereal consumed the same amount of calories but felt fuller longer and more satisfied, thanks to oatmeal’s high fiber content. Oats are rich in fiber, so a serving can help you feel full throughout the day.

For the purpose of fighting fat with fat, avocados are high in monounsaturated fatty acids, which can help diminish belly fat. Throw some slices on your morning toast, or try different healthy recipes with these. Oleic acid, a compound in avocados’ healthy monounsaturated fats (MUFAs), may trigger your body to actually quiet hunger. The creamy fruit is also packed with fiber and protein.

